Headquartered in Perry, Georgia, C&H Tooling operates as a specialized entity within the Industrial Machinery & Equipment industry. By maintaining a lean workforce of 20 to 49 professionals, the organization has demonstrated agility in delivering high-precision tooling solutions. With annual revenues currently positioned in the 1M to 5M range, the company serves as a critical node in the regional supply chain, providing essential hardware that supports broader manufacturing processes. How much funding has C&H Tooling raised?

C&H Tooling has raised a total of $382K across 2 funding rounds:

2020

Debt

$150K

2021

Debt

$232K

Debt (2020): $150K with participation from PPP

Debt (2021): $232K led by PPP
